I would like to make a "message flow" diagram that shows an Outlook User, an Exchange server, and a Mail Gateway, and show each "step" that the message takes as it travels through the system, from the sender to the recipient.

I'm looking for suggested way to diagram this.

It's easy to draw the various servers/networks that are involved, but how to effectively communicate what is happening at each step?



Paul Herber

Create one simple diagram on a page, duplicate the page for as many animation stages you need, then on each page highlight the appropriate shape in a suitable way. Then export the pages as images, these can be used standalone or imported into P/P or whatever.
